Born in San Antonio, Texas, by age two I was in Okinawa and followed as an Air Force brat my father all over the Pacific Rim and the United States from Seattle to Albany, Georgia, stopping in El Paso to attend high school and the University of Texas at El Paso, and later across the pond with an employer to Belgium. Whew, not only was that a long sentence but it filled my passport with a number of exotic stamps. Once I got involved with mission projects through my church, I required another passport to include stamps from countries and trips down through Mexico, Central and South America.

In 1992, while working in Mexico City, I had my first heart attack, followed by my first open heart surgery. After a succession of angioplasties and stents, I quit hiking the mountains in Guatemala and began consulting, counseling, speaking, sailing and finally at age 65, I started writing Christian fiction and devotionals. BURIED is my debut novel, THE SECRET, its sequel is scheduled to be published in early 2013. A series of adventures with a long haul truck driver, GOD ON BOARD, is planned for 2014.

Four great kids, six super grand kids and a wonderful wife keep me from spending all my time writing.

A fast-paced saga of drama, suspense, and inspiration. Police pursuits, auto crashes, animal attacks, and a mine collapse. This rapid read ends less than thirty-four hours after it begins. Set in 1968 in the panhandle of Oklahoma, this inspirational story reveals how the character of a man trapped in a mining accident impacts a young newspaper reporter desperate for a life-changing story.

A young author and English instructor from the University of Washington has come to Oklahoma to interview his grandfather to discover the secret surrounding a mining accident in 1968 which buried alive Tom Howard, his “Papa Tom”. Our hero becomes exposed to more than just secrets: a woman, a dangerous criminal, and truths that will both inspire and break your heart.
